The area around Armagh is quite interesting. Lough Neagh is the largest lake in Ireland. Peatlands Park, about 15 km from Armagh, is a very informative park about peat bogs and a good place to hike around the exhibits.

We did the walking tour and it was well worth the £6. Armagh is a city full of history and there is a core group of people working very hard to keep the city alive and vibrant. It is a very friendly city where everyone seems to know everyone else and outsiders are made very welcome. We also visited the Planetarium/Observatory and that is a treat for any age group. There are also lovely walks around it. We ate in Keegan's pub (ask anyone the way to it) and loved the food and the Guinness. I would very highly recommend a visit to Armagh for people of any age, there is something there for everyone.
